I am reading "The Imitaiton of Christ" by Thomas A Kempis. It is right up there with Augustine's Confessions, as an absolute classic in Christian spirituality which should be read by all Christians.

I will be excerpting bits of it on the blog from time to time as I read through this seminal work.

Here's the first:

"Who has a fiercer struggle than he who strives to conquer himself? Yet this must be our chief concern - to conquer self, and by daily growing stronger than self, to advance in holiness."

"In the day of judgment we shall not be asked what we read but what we did, not how well we spoke, but how well we lived."
